Substrates and Products (Substrate)

Substrates Comment Substrates Organism Products Comment (Products) Rev. Reac.
2-hydroxy-dATP + H2O
-
Homo sapiens 2-hydroxy-dAMP + diphosphate
-
?
2-hydroxy-dATP + H2O hydrolyzed more efficiently and with higher affinity than 8-oxo-dATP. Preferential hydrolysis of 2-oxo-dATP over 8-oxo-dGTP is observed at all of the pH values tested (pH 7.2 to pH 8.8). A 5fold difference in the hydrolysis efficiencies for 2-oxo-dATP over 8-oxo-dGTP is found at pH 7.2. In addition to the normal form of hMTH1 (valine 83), the variant form of the protein (methionine 83) also hydrolyzes 2-oxo-dATP more efficiently than 8-oxo-dGTP Homo sapiens 2-hydroxy-dAMP + diphosphate
-
?
8-oxo-dATP + H2O hydrolyzed as efficiently as 8-oxo-dGTP Homo sapiens 8-oxo-dAMP + diphosphate
-
?
8-oxo-dGTP + H2O this enzyme is a 2-hydroxy-dATP diphosphatase that also exhibits activity with 8-oxo-dGTP Homo sapiens 8-oxo-dGMP + diphosphate
-
?
dGTP + H2O
-
Homo sapiens dGMP + diphosphate
-
?
additional information no hydrolysis of (R)-8,5'-cyclodATP, 5-oxo-dCTP, and 5-formyl-dUTP Homo sapiens ?
-
?

pH Optimum

pH Optimum Minimum pH Optimum Maximum Comment Organism
7.7 8.8 hydrolysis of 2-hydroxy-dATP Homo sapiens
7.7 8.2 hydrolysis of 8-oxo-dGTP Homo sapiens

pH Range

pH Minimum pH Maximum Comment Organism
7.2 8.8 pH 7.2: about 60% of maximal activity, pH 8.8: about 95% of maximal activity, hydrolysis of 2-hydroxy-dATP Homo sapiens
7.7 8.8 pH 7.2: about 15% of maximal activity, pH 7.7: about 95% of maximal activity, pH 8.8: about 50% of maximal activity, hydrolysis of 8-oxo-dGTP Homo sapiens
